A disability lawyer fibromyalgia service involves an attorney who has deep experience in securing Social Security Disability benefits for people suffering from fibromyalgia. Unlike standard legal help, a disability lawyer fibromyalgia advocate knows the SSA's specific criteria for this condition — including SSA Ruling 12-2p, which outlines how fibromyalgia claims are evaluated. This ruling requires documented widespread pain and certain additional symptoms, all of which your attorney will build a record around.

Mechanically, the representation involves assembling medical records, communicating with your treating physicians, and constructing a Residual Functional Capacity (RFC) assessment that accurately shows how your fibromyalgia limits your ability to work. Does fibromyalgia automatically qualify for disability benefits?

No — a diagnosis on its own is not sufficient. The SSA requires documented evidence that your particular limitations prevent meaningful employment. A disability lawyer fibromyalgia professional helps you prove that case in a way that satisfies SSA criteria, including SSA Ruling 12-2p, rather than depending solely on a diagnosis letter.

What symptoms does the SSA look for in fibromyalgia cases?

Under SSA Ruling 12-2p, the SSA looks for documented widespread pain lasting at least three months plus 11 of 18 tender points or, alternatively, pervasive discomfort alongside at least six fibromyalgia symptoms such as anxiety.
